From our experience since 2017 in swiftlet farming, building a comfortable RBW (swiftlet house) is actually the easy part — it’s simply about managing temperature, humidity, applying the right scent (especially for new buildings), and arranging the layout to allow easy maneuvering all the way to the roosting room.
However, the most challenging part is creating a sound system that delivers consistent responses throughout all seasons — from the entrance (LMB) and attraction areas (LAR) to the stay-in room. Choosing sound components that can truly trigger a swiftlet's natural instincts to enter and stay overnight is critical.
